Partager via


ImportEngine.PreviewImports(ComposablePart, AtomicComposition) Méthode

Définition

Affiche un aperçu de toutes les importations requises pour la partie spécifiée afin de s'assurer qu'elles peuvent être satisfaites, sans les définir réellement.

public:
 void PreviewImports(System::ComponentModel::Composition::Primitives::ComposablePart ^ part, System::ComponentModel::Composition::Hosting::AtomicComposition ^ atomicComposition);
public void PreviewImports (System.ComponentModel.Composition.Primitives.ComposablePart part, System.ComponentModel.Composition.Hosting.AtomicComposition atomicComposition);
public void PreviewImports (System.ComponentModel.Composition.Primitives.ComposablePart part, System.ComponentModel.Composition.Hosting.AtomicComposition? atomicComposition);
member this.PreviewImports : System.ComponentModel.Composition.Primitives.ComposablePart * System.ComponentModel.Composition.Hosting.AtomicComposition -> unit
Public Sub PreviewImports (part As ComposablePart, atomicComposition As AtomicComposition)

Paramètres

part
ComposablePart

Partie dont un aperçu des importations doit être affiché.

atomicComposition
AtomicComposition

Transaction de composition à utiliser ou null si aucune transaction de composition n'existe.

Exceptions

Une erreur s’est produite lors de l’aperçu, et atomicComposition est null. Errors contiendra une collection d'erreurs qui se sont produites. La composition préexistante est dans un état inconnu, en fonction des erreurs qui se sont produites.

Une erreur s’est produite lors de l’aperçu, et atomicComposition n’est pas null. Errors contiendra une collection d'erreurs qui se sont produites. La composition préexistante reste dans un état valide.

S’applique à